licheng700

          BlogJava 首頁 新隨筆 聯系 聚合 管理
            26 Posts :: 5 Stories :: 5 Comments :: 1 Trackbacks

          package iss.com.equals;

          import java.util.Date;

          class CountIsable {

           private Date date;

           private String accountNo;

           private String bankCode;

           public CountIsable(Date transactionTime, String accountNo, String bankCode) {
            this.date = transactionTime;
            this.accountNo = accountNo;
            this.bankCode = bankCode;
           }

           public CountIsable(String accountNo, String bankCode) {
            this.accountNo = accountNo;
            this.bankCode = bankCode;
           }
                         
           public boolean equals(CountIsable mapKey) {
            if (DateUtil.compareDate(date, mapKey.getDate()) == 0
              && accountNo.equals(mapKey.getAccountNo())) {
             if (mapKey.getBankCode() == null
               || mapKey.getBankCode().equals(bankCode))
              return true;
            }
            return false;
           }
           public boolean equals(Object key) {
            CountIsable mapKey=(CountIsable)key;
            if (DateUtil.compareDate(date, mapKey.getDate()) == 0
              && accountNo.equals(mapKey.getAccountNo())) {
             if (mapKey.getBankCode() == null
               || mapKey.getBankCode().equals(bankCode))
              return true;
            }
            return false;
           }

           public String toString() {
            return date.toString() + accountNo + bankCode;
           }

          public int hashCode() {
           int temp =(date.toString() + accountNo + bankCode).hashCode(); 
            return temp;
           }

           public String getAccountNo() {
            return accountNo;
           }

           public String getBankCode() {
            return bankCode;
           }

           public Date getDate() {
            return date;
           }
          }

          posted on 2005-07-29 10:04 小海船 閱讀(531) 評論(0)  編輯  收藏

          只有注冊用戶登錄后才能發表評論。


          網站導航:
           
          主站蜘蛛池模板: 惠水县| 武功县| 吉木乃县| 宜都市| 丰城市| 富裕县| 泽库县| 五原县| 郧西县| 海原县| 成安县| 庄河市| 金寨县| 弋阳县| 息烽县| 冕宁县| 西充县| 江川县| 上蔡县| 灵川县| 进贤县| 东至县| 运城市| 小金县| 海南省| 宁波市| 汾阳市| 三穗县| 昌邑市| 玉屏| 绍兴市| 东乡族自治县| 台中县| 荥阳市| 青河县| 桦南县| 民县| 德江县| 张掖市| 海盐县| 夹江县|